Equipment for filming
Submitted by Jonny Durand Jr on Thu, 08/14/2008 - 21:35.I have had many request from pilots wanting to know what I am using for these films. I am only using my digital still camera in movie mode. The camera is a Cannon Powershot SD 870IS which belongs in my side pocket of my Matrix race. I have no camera mount on my glider I am just holding the camera in my left hand whilst filming. I am using the correct foam to cancel out the wind noise a little but as I am flying a Litespeed there is still some wind noise in the background. I hope this answers most of your questions.

Brasillia Day 4
Submitted by Jonny Durand Jr on Wed, 08/13/2008 - 16:57.A 89kms task was set with 4 turnpoints then landing back in Brasillia. The day was a little windy and the climbs were not as good as yesterday. Andre and I had another great start and slowly the gaggle caught up to us between 1st and 2nd turnpoint.
I was flying conservative and then got low after missing a thermal that Andre and Nene got after the 3rd turpoint. I had to scratch for awhile before getting up and and heading to goal. I arrived about 6 mins behind Andre and Nene and will come in about 6-7th for the day. For inflight entertainment check the video out below.

Brasillia Day 3
Submitted by Jonny Durand Jr on Tue, 08/12/2008 - 21:09.A 122kms task with 4 turnpoints before landing in the Esplanada. Andre and I planned our tactics before launch and the task went as planned. We gained a early lead by having a good start and were able to pull away even more from the gaggle as the task went on. Andre was dragging me along all day so that I could make the videos for you to watch.
